Curent Condition of the Gables Condo Market

Downtown Dadeland Condo for Rent $2,350/month. (305) 975-8158 Gables current condo inventory has fallen to levels last seen in the summer of 2006. That was when the supply began to rise. Over the past 12 months, the number of available condos has fallen by approx. 25% , which is a better condition for Sellers. On the other hand, prices per square foot have fallen about 36% to 41%, which is a good thing for Buyers. Coral Gables Museum Receives Preservation Award

Ramona Busot & Jeannett Slesnick Museum Board Members The Florida Trust for Historic Preservation recognized the City of Coral Gables this year for outstanding achievement in the field of restoration/rehabilitation for the Coral Gables Museum project.  The award will be presented during the Florida Trust for Historic Preservation's annual conference to take place in Winter Park, Florida.

Coral Gables Real Estate Inventory Decline

Americans are more confident than ever about the stability of home prices than they were at the beginning of 2010, according to Fannie Mae’s national housing survey (Dec. 2010). Meanwhile in Coral Gables, inventory of single-family homes continues to drop. It appears to be the first time that inventory has been below 400 homes since 2006.

2011 Home Prices Stabilize Across the U.S.

The Mortgage Bankers Association predicts the number of mortgage applications for home purchases will increase and home prices will stabilize this year, as reported on MSNBC's "7 Mortgage Trends to Expect in 2011."  Real estate analysts predict several other trends for 2011... • Experts say rates will increase to 5 percent in 2011, 6 percent in 2012. • The number of jumbo loans (loans over $417,000 in most housing markets and above $729,750 in high-cost housing markets) are expected to rise in the next few months. • All-cash purchases represented about a quarter of all existing home purchases in the last four months of 2010, according to Lawrence Yun, chief economist of the National Association of Realtors. He expects all-cash purchases to continue to represent a big part of the real estate landscape in 2011.
